What is the value of the missing exponent in the equation 652 : 10- = 0.652?

Respuesta :

AmeinaI187704 AmeinaI187704
  • 03-11-2022

Given the following expression:

[tex]\frac{652}{10^{^-}}=0.652[/tex]

notice that the right side of the equation has a decimal number that goes up to the thousandth, therefore, the missing exponent in the equation is 3, since:

[tex]\frac{652}{10^3}=\frac{652}{1000}=0.652[/tex]
